Join a global media organisation who's mission is to empower the most iconic brands in media for business and creative success by creating the next-generation suite of content publishing and consumption experiences. We are looking for a Product Design Director to lead the design of user experiences and an international design team of one of their most iconic brands.
A global media organisation who’s mission is to empower the most iconic brands in media for business and creative success by creating the next-generation suite of content publishing and consumption experiences. The company’s portfolio includes many of the world’s most respected and influential media brands.
They produce high quality content that has a footprint of more than 1 billion consumers across 32 territories through print, digital, video and social platforms.
Their content reaches 84 million consumers in print 367 million in digital and 379 million across social platforms generating more than 1 billion video views each month.
You’ll join a group of designers, product managers, engineers, strategists, and researchers dedicated to building innovative, user-centric products. These products play a critical role in the the future of each brand in the portfolio.
We are now looking for a Product Design Director to lead the design of user experiences and an international design team of one of their most iconic brands.
As the Product Design Director you will be responsible for bringing to life industry leading user experiences, with their users’ needs at their core.
The Team
Your immediate team is made up of experienced visual, interaction, content, and research. But will also partner closely with editorial, product management, engineering, and business partners to strategise, design, and launch ambitious digital products.
Tghe organisation firmly believe that a well-formed design culture, with strong cross-collaboration is essential to delivering top-notch work.
Key Responsibilities:
Design strategy – You’ll have a deep understanding of how great design can drive overall business results. You’ll provide vision and direction, in collaboration with your cross-functional partners, to articulate a compelling vision for the user experience across a portfolio of digital products. You’ll need to be an expert in aligning business goals with user’s needs, to create engaging, user-centric experiences.
Insights driven approach – Qualitative research and data is essential in forming a strong foundation for design work. In collaboration with partners in the UX Research team, Product Analytics and Audience Development, you will draw sophisticated, actionable insights to inform your design direction, as well as assess the success of your initiatives.
End to end design – There are multiple users to serve (internal, as well as external) and numerous touch points to consider in designing a coherent user experience. TYou will be responsible for orchestrating the end-to-end product experience and its ecosystem – from the publishing of content, the integration of consumer revenue and commercial experiences, through to the end user experience on and off platform.
Team leadership – You will be responsible for leading a high functioning team and establish the culture and processes necessary to set up your team for success. You will lead a team of product designers, researchers and content designers, working in a matrixed organisation. You will also be a close partner to Product, Engineering, Editorial, Audience Development, Consumer Revenue, Commercial and more. You’ll need to navigate the needs of a complex group of stakeholders and corral teams around a shared perspective to chart the path forwards.
Design Leadership – This role is an essential part of the wider Design Leadership team, who set the tone and shape of the organisational culture and the broader design strategy, while also championing the value of design and research.
Champion the brand – You’ll need a nuanced understanding of how to bring an established brand to life within the digital space, and be able to collaborate with creative partners to create a cohesive, cross-platform brand experience.
